Senior Director, Global Infrastructure at Avis Budget Group (Parsippany-Troy Hills, NJ)

The position will be located at Avis Budget Group's HQ in Parsippany, NJ.


The Senior Director, Global Infrastructure will plan, organize, and direct corporate-wide desktop hardware & software deployment(s), Service Desk support, VIP services, voice/data telecommunications, server administration, storage networks, database administration, operations architecture, messaging, data center operations & production control, information security operations, program management, and disaster recovery.


The Senior Director, Global Infrastructure will:
Own responsibility for managing Americas enterprise technology infrastructure planning, deployment, operations, and support. This includes, but is not limited to, computer operations and production support, systems and database administration, network operations, PC/desktop support and service desk, security, program management office, and disaster recovery.
Own responsibility for the performance of sourcing partners engaged in the delivery of all IT Operations activities, including daily service performance and results based on Service Level Objectives.
Leadership of sourcing partner governance activities based on established standards and partner contracts.
Actively participate in the review of infrastructure projects and of architecture standards. Assist in the evaluation of new projects prior to the approval of projects for implementation into the IT operations environment.
Serve as technical resource for planning in all areas of IT service delivery, including on premise systems (mainframe, distributed, network, etc.) and emerging Cloud based services.
Establish and maintain a trusted advisor role as a Technology Leader.
Ensure proactive maintenance of the technology environment; including compliance with governance and regulatory requirements and security management. Consistently monitor the risks and operations associated with information protection and disaster recovery for critical IT systems.
Promote continuous improvement by leveraging new technology practices, benchmarking, and identifying quality improvement methodologies.
Build, coach, and mentor the IT Team to help build ABG's technical leadership talent pipeline around succession planning.
Provide effective resource management both for internal activities and sourcing partners to proactively balance the support of daily operations and the strategic direction and governance of technology assets.
Provide leadership and work with Team Leaders and functional Staff to ensure a high performance, customer service-oriented work environment that supports achieving IT's and the Company's mission, strategic plan, objectives, and values.
Stay abreast of emerging technologies that will effectively enhance company technology vision and strategy. Assist in the evaluation of technology platforms and the deployment of technology projects and solutions.
Oversee initiatives to proactively support knowledge sharing and professional development within the technology teams.
Participate in the development of (and monitor performance against the) IT Department budget.
Thoroughly understand and assess risk/return profiles of technologies when determining an investment decision.
Collaborate closely with colleagues responsible for application development and enterprise architecture on defining the technology standards and roadmaps.


Qualifications:
Bachelor's degree in business or a related discipline; an Advanced degree would be preferred.
Minimum of 10 years' experience in an IT function, including a minimum of 5 years in an IT management role.
Minimum of 10 years' experience in state of the art data center operations including infrastructure services, operations center, information protection, and network security procedures.
Must have managed a large scale high availability environment for at least 5 years.
Significant people and financial management experience required.
Rental car industry experience and knowledge is a plus.
